Axle seals, front and drive shaft seals will also need to be replaced. In some cases the Transmission Control Computer is internal and incorporated with valve body, which may require body to be replaced. Transfer cases will not be included with transmissions from 4x4 or All Wheel Drive vehicles. Some external sensors or solenoids may need to be replaced.

Transmission lines will need flushed, along with the transmission oil cooler replaced if equipped, this needs to be done so contaminants from bad not ruin your replacement. Buyer will need to replace the transmission oil filter, pan gasket, flush and add manufacturer specific fluids. Over 6,000 vehicles in the yard and more arriving daily.
